As soon as your doctor or other healthcare provider refers you for home health and wellness solutions, the home wellness company will schedule a visit and involve your home to speak with you about your requirements and ask you some concerns concerning your health. The home wellness company team will certainly likewise talk to your medical professional or various other wellness care supplier about your care and keep your them updated on your progress.
Inspect that you're taking your prescription and various other drugs and any type of therapies correctly. Inspect your safety and security in the home. Instruct you concerning your care so you can take care of on your own.
This suggests they must connect on a regular basis with you, your doctor or other health treatment service provider, and any person else who provides you care.

The target audience for your non-medical home care company will certainly commonly be the adult children of senior people.
As a non-medical home care service, you might likewise offer look after grownups with handicaps. In this instance, your target audience will certainly be the moms and dads or guardians of the individuals for whom you will eventually provide care. To locate clients for your non-medical home treatment organization, you need to attach with local doctor's workplaces, recovery centers, and neighborhood.
You might likewise take into consideration developing a profile and looking for work on sites like C, where you can get in touch with customers for totally free. And, if you have an active social media network, connect in the early days of your business to see if any of your connections are seeking home care services.
When family members are looking for a person to offer look after their enjoyed ones, they're mosting likely to do their research study to ensure whoever they work with depends on snuff. A non-medical home treatment company makes money by providing the assistance customers require to live life safely in your home. Treatment suppliers are generally paid by the hour, and are acquired with for weeks or months each time.
Costs can be low when beginning a non-medical home care business, though they may extend into the thousands depending on your state's licensing requirements. Several states require you to get a certificate to provide care at customers' homes, also if it's non-medical.

Look into your state's division of health and wellness (or related bureau) web site to find out a lot more, or contact the department directly with concerns. Some states may also require you to have certain qualifications, such as CPR or emergency treatment training, prior to offering non-medical home treatment
Non-medical home care suppliers usually bill a hourly price of $15-$27. What you bill will depend on your area and the services you supply.

For some, the term covers both experienced home health and wellness care along with non-medical home wellness treatment. entails help with everyday living activities most generally for elderly people who want to continue to be in their homes
on the other hand, includes nursing or healing services supplied in the client's very own home which would generally be supplied in a healthcare facility or medical facility. In 2013, The United States and Canada made up just over 40 percent of the global home healthcare income. The fad towards home healthcare is just as strong across the north boundary. The Canadian Nurses Organization (CNA) anticipates that two-thirds of registered nurses in Canada will certainly be operating in the area by 2020, contrasted to 30 percent in 2006.
